This bipartisan and bicameral legislation would reauthorize the Nursing Workforce Development Programs (Title VIII of the Public Health Service Act [42 U.S.C. 296 et. seq]) through Fiscal Year 2030 and align them with current needs in the profession. The Title VIII Nursing Workforce Development Programs comprise the largest dedicated federal funding for nursing and strengthen all aspects of the nursing workforce, including education, practice, recruitment, and retention, especially in rural and underserved areas. Support for these programs is critical to creating, maintaining, and promoting high-quality, patient-centered care across a range of settings.
